What is the difference between Mail Operations Manager vs Mail Clerk?
| Aspect | Mail Operations Manager | Mail Clerk |
|---|---|---|
| Responsibilities | Oversees mail processing, logistics, staff management, and operational efficiency | Sorts, distributes, and handles incoming and outgoing mail |
| Required Skills | Leadership, logistics, organizational skills, knowledge of mailing systems | Attention to detail, basic organizational skills, familiarity with mailing procedures |
| Work Environment | Office or warehouse setting, managerial role | Mailroom or front desk area, entry-level role |
| Certifications | Typically none required, but logistics or management certifications can help | None required |
The Mail Operations Manager focuses on overseeing the entire mail process, managing staff, and ensuring efficiency, while the Mail Clerk handles the day-to-day sorting and distribution of mail. The manager role requires leadership skills and broader responsibilities, whereas the clerk role is more operational and task-focused.

Job description
Job Title: Product Coordinator Supervisor
Department: Transportation
Reports To: Product Coordinating Manager
FLSA Status: Exempt
Come join our Team as a Product Coordinator Supervisor! We started with pastries handmade by Lois and Lloyd Martin produced inside of a garage and we have boomed into a multi-facility company where our many products are produced by machines and shipped domestically and internationally. Talk about a rich history and exciting future! As an employer of choice we offer physical, emotional, financial and professional benefits including 401K, disability insurance and paid holidays.
As a member of the Martin's Family, the Product Coordinator Supervisor plans and coordinates finished product actives to ensure the orders are prepared.
Essential Duties and Responsivities: include the following. Other duties may be assigned.
- Directs and monitors orders from the computer system and accurately corrects paperwork to reflect new orders.
- Assigns job tasks to workers according to loading and unloading schedules.
- Establishes and adjusts employee work schedules to meet production and distribution schedules.
- Studies orders and estimates the labor hour requirements.
- Directs the placement of product in the storage areas to ensure the flow of product in an efficient and timely manner.
- Directs the loading of product to ensure load efficiencies and to also prevent shifting or damage to materials or products during transit.
- Directs and monitors the loading and unloading of materials against work order or bill of lading.
- Oversees scheduling of the movement of materials into and out of the storage areas.
- Acts as the primary communication liaison for the department.
- Interacts and communicates with Production, Sales, Schedulers and Transportation to coordinate projections and activities of the individual departments.
- Directs and coordinates scheduling for all jockeys.
- Oversees internal department mail and mail order shipping.
- Directs and monitors the loading of route sales trucks.
- Facilitates the movement of supplies and materials between plants.
- Maintains an active role on the Food Safety Committee and Risk Assessment Team.
- Analyzes any unexpected issues that may arise and directs the department on how to handle effectively.
- Directs and monitors the transport and processing of stale product.
- Direct and monitor the transport of empty baskets to the conveyor lines.
- Interprets company policies to workers.
- Recommends measures to improve production methods, equipment performance and quality or product and logistics of finished product.
- Analyzes and resolves work problems or assists workers in solving work problems.
- Initiates or suggests plans to motivate workers to achieve work goals.
- Confers with other supervisors to coordinate activities to individual departments.
- Assisting corporate dispatch team
- Schedules employees within the Finished Product Department.
- Ensures cleanliness of work area is maintained.
- Facilitate safety meetings with Product Coordinators.
Adheres to and enforces safety, food safety, quality, and Good Manufacturing Practices regulations.
